Over 500 lakh (50 million) toilets built under Swachh Bharat Mission: India

By: Eastern Eye Staff

On Monday minister of state for drinking water and sanitation Ramesh Chandappa Jigajinagi told the Upper House that it built 561.75 lakh toilets under the Swachh Bharat Mission (rural). From that nearly 29.08 lakh toilets were constructed under the MGNREGA and seven states/UTs were declared Open Defecation Free (ODF), he added. In a written reply, the government said the Swachh Bharat Mission was a demand-driven scheme and hence state-wise funds were not allocated.
